Ex-Red Bull driver Christian Klien believes Sebastian Vettel still has what it takes to deliver for Aston Martin in the midfield.

The four-time World Champion endured a torrid 2020 at Ferrari, knowing before the season even began that he would not be retained beyond that season.

Some expected him to retire, but instead he signed a multi-year deal with Aston Martin, a team searching for a driver with the experience of success to direct them to the front of the grid.

The early stages of 2021 were a struggle for Vettel, and while still not consistently back to his best, there have been some strong performances like his P2 in Baku, Monaco and Hungary before he was disqualified from P2 for a fuel sample violation.
